In a bold statement today, US Vice President Kamala Harris called for an urgent ceasefire in Gaza, emphasizing the need to address the immense suffering in the region. With the conflict escalating and civilian casualties mounting, Harris stressed the importance of swift action to bring an end to the violence.

“Given the immense scale of suffering in Gaza, there must be an immediate ceasefire,” Vice President Harris stated. “For at least the next six weeks, which is what is currently on the table. This will get the hostages out, and get a significant amount of aid in.”
“Hamas needs to accept it,” the Vice President added.
In her statement, Harris also highlighted the humanitarian crisis unfolding in Gaza, where countless lives are at risk and essential services are severely disrupted. She underscored the urgency of reuniting hostages with their families and providing immediate relief to the people of Gaza.
“This would allow us to build something more enduring to ensure Israel is secure, and to respect the right of Palestinian people to dignity, freedom, and self-determination,” Harris emphasized.
The Vice President’s remarks come amidst intensifying Israeli offences in Gaza, leading to a tragic loss of life and widespread destruction. The situation has drawn international condemnation and calls for a ceasefire from leaders around the world.
“Hamas claims it wants a ceasefire. Well, there is a deal on the table. Let’s get a ceasefire. Let’s reunite the hostages with their families, and let’s provide immediate relief to the people of Gaza,” Harris urged, urging all parties to prioritize the well-being of civilians and work towards a sustainable resolution to the conflict.
